CHROMIUM TRIOXIDE continued
 HAZARD ALERT: Known carcinogen. Corrosive to skin; highly
toxic; powerful oxidizing agent. Avoid contact with reducing agents and organic material. Possible reproductive/fertility hazard. Practice strict hygiene in the use of this substance. LD50 80 mg/kg.
Storage: Inorganic #4
Disposal: #12a
Shelf Life: Poor (deliquescent); store in a Flinn Chem-Saf TM Bag and then inside a Flinn Saf-StorTM Can.
Soluble: Water, alcohol, and mineral acids.
Color and Odor: Rose/red, odorless solid.
CAS No. 1333-82-0
Incompatibility: Reducing agents or organics; violent reaction possible.

Technical Note: Used for cheese-making demonstrations and experiments. Prepare solutions fresh: dissolve 0.3 g chymosin in 100 mL of bottled water. Use two drops of solution per 10-mL sample size of milk. Optimum temperature for enzyme activity is 40 oC. Two grams of C0419 should be enough to coagulate more than 100 L of milk!
